Broadway: Carousel; Hello, Dolly! (Tony Award for costume design); Cafe Crown (Tony for set design); The Cherry Orchard (Tony for costume design); Grand Hotel (Tony for costume design). Seventeen additional Tony nominations. Film credits include Radio Days (Academy Award nomination for production design), Bullets Over Broadway (Academy Award nomination for production design), and Zelig (Academy Award nomination for costume design). He received the Michael Merritt Award for Excellence in Design and Collaboration in 2002, was inducted into the Theater Hall of Fame in 2004, received the Pennsylvania Governor's Award for the Arts in 2006, the Robert L.B. Tobin Award for Lifetime Achievement, and the Breukelein Institute Gaudium Award in 2013.

Santo Loquasto has been nominated for several awards throughout his career. Some of his notable nominations include Outstanding Costume Design for a Musical at the Drama Desk Awards for "The Music Man," Outstanding Costume Design (Play or Musical) at the Outer Critics Circle Awards for "The Music Man," Best Costume Design of a Musical at the Tony Awards for "The Music Man," Best Scenic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"Gary: A Sequel to Titus Andronicus," and Outstanding Set Design for a Musical at the Drama Desk Awards for "Carousel." He has also been nominated for Outstanding Costume Design for a Musical at the Drama Desk Awards, Outstanding Set Design for a Musical at the Drama Desk Awards, Outstanding Costume Design (Play or Musical) at the Outer Critics Circle Awards, and Best Costume Design of a Musical at the Tony Awards for his work on "Hello, Dolly!" Additionally, Loquasto received nominations for Best Scenic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"Eugene O'Neill's The Iceman Cometh," Best Scenic Design of a Musical at the Tony Awards for "Shuffle Along, Or the Making of the Musical Sensation of 1921 and All That Followed," and Outstanding Set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"Bullets Over Broadway: The Musical" and "The Assembled Parties." Other nominations include Outstanding Costume Design, Resident Production at the Helen Hayes Awards for "Ragtime," Best Scenic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"Fences," Outstanding Set Design at the Outer Critics Circle Awards for "Waiting for Godot," Best Costume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"Inherit the Wind," Outstanding Costume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"Suddenly Last Summer," Best Costume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"A Touch of the Poet," Best Scenic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"Three Days of Rain," Outstanding Set Design of a Play at the Drama Desk Awards for "Glengarry Glen Ross," Best Scenic Design of a Play at the Tony Awards for "Glengarry Glen Ross," and Best Scenic Design at the Tony Awards for "Long Day's Journey into Night." Loquasto has also received nominations for Outstanding Costume Design at the Outer Critics Circle Awards for "The Elephant Man" and "Fosse," Best Costume Design at the Tony Awards for "Fosse," Outstanding Set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"Mizlansky/Zilinsky or 'schmucks'," Best Costume Design at the Outer Critics Circle Awards and the Tony Awards for "Ragtime," Outstanding Set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"A Month in the Country," Outstanding Choreography at the Drama Desk Awards for "Lost in Yonkers," and Outstanding Costume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"Grand Hotel." Other nominations include Costume Design at The Hewes Awards for "Grand Hotel" and "Agamemnon," Best Scenic Design at the Tony Awards for "The Suicide," Outstanding Set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"King of Hearts," "The Play's the Thing," "The Cherry Orchard," "American Buffalo," "Legend," and "Kennedy's Children," Special Citations for Sets and costumes at the Obie Awards for "Comedy of Errors," and Best Scenic Design at the Tony Awards for "What the Wine-Sellers Buy" and "That Championship Season."
Santo Loquasto has won several awards throughout his career. Some of his notable wins include Best Costume Design of a Musical at the Tony Awards for "Hello, Dolly!", Outstanding Costume Design, Resident Production at the Helen Hayes Awards for "Ragtime", Outstanding Set Design of a Play at the Drama Desk Awards for "Glengarry Glen Ross", and Outstanding Costume Design at the Drama Desk Awards for "Ragtime". He has also won awards for his work on "Mizlansky/Zilinsky or 'schmucks'", "Grand Hotel", "American Buffalo", "The Cherry Orchard", "Agamemnon", and "Comedy of Errors". Additionally, he received Special Citations for Sets and costumes at the Obie Awards for his work on "Comedy of Errors".
